×
Register Here to Apply for Jobs or Post Jobs. X

Sviluppatore Front End

Job in Turin, Piedmont, Italy
Listing for: RCS S.p.A.
Full Time position
Listed on 2026-06-23
Job specializations:
  • Software Development
    Front End Developer
Job Description & How to Apply Below
RCS S.p.A.  opera dal 1993 nel mercato mondiale dei servizi a supporto dell’attività investigativa degli Enti Governativi. Progetta, sviluppa e offre assistenza all’esercizio di sistemi integrati destinati al monitoraggio e all’analisi delle comunicazioni per l'impiego nelle indagini dell'Autorità Giudiziaria.

La squadra di RCS si allarga!

Oggi vogliamo integrare il nostro team con uno  Front End Developer

Quale sarà la tua sfida?

Entrerai a far parte di un team cross-funzionale agile, dedicandoti allo sviluppo di una web-app ad altissime performance per il monitoraggio dati in tempo reale. L'architettura è moderna, scalabile e basata su  React e TypeScript . La sfida principale del ruolo sarà garantire la fluidità dell'interfaccia utente (UX) e l'efficienza dei flussi di rendering a fronte di flussi massivi di dati in tempo reale (streaming di dati), mantenendo elevati standard di sicurezza e stabilità.

Responsabilità

Progettare, sviluppare e ottimizzare componenti e interfacce utente reattive e accessibili in React e TypeScript.
Gestire flussi di dati in tempo reale ad alta frequenza, ottimizzando la gestione dello stato globale e i cicli di re-render dell'applicazione.
Scrivere codice pulito, documentato e manutenibile. Partecipare attivamente alle  code review  interpersonali per promuovere la condivisione della conoscenza.
Scrivere test automatizzati (unitari, di integrazione ed E2E) e monitorare la qualità del software e le vulnerabilità tramite strumenti di analisi statica.
Collaborare a stretto contatto con il team Backend per la definizione di contratti API efficienti (REST, Web Socket).
Contribuire al monitoraggio e all'evoluzione delle pipeline di CI/CD per garantire rilasci continui, sicuri e automatizzati.

Requisiti chiave

Laurea in Ingegneria Informatica, Informatica, discipline STEM o background equivalente.
Capacità di scomporre problemi complessi in soluzioni software lineari ed efficienti.
Almeno  1-2 anni  di esperienza pratica (inclusi stage, progetti universitari o progetti personali strutturati) focalizzata su  React e TypeScript .
Ottima conoscenza di React (Hooks, Context API) e TypeScript, unita a una forte motivazione all'apprendimento delle migliori pratiche di sviluppo (Clean Code, principi SOLID).
Padronanza di HTML5, CSS3 e preprocessori/metodologie moderne ( SASS, CSS Modules o Tailwind ).
Esperienza nell'integrazione di sistemi di comunicazione in tempo reale ( Web Socket , StompJS).
Familiarità con strumenti di testing ( Jest, Vitest , Testing Library) e utilizzo di Git associato all'ecosistema  Git Lab / Git Lab CI .
Conoscenza delle tematiche di ottimizzazione lato client (Core Web Vitals, caching, lazy loading).
Buona conoscenza della lingua inglese (lettura di documentazione tecnica e collaborazione internazionale).

Requisiti Preferenziali (Costituiscono un plus)

Anzianità lavorativa maggiore (4+ anni), attitudine al mentoring di profili junior e capacità di guidare scelte architetturali sul frontend.
Conoscenza approfondita dei pattern di gestione dello stato su larga scala ( Redux Toolkit, Zustand  o similari).
Esperienza con librerie di data visualization per la gestione di dati massivi in tempo reale (es.  D3.js, Recharts , Chart.js).
Esperienza con strumenti di monitoraggio, analisi statica e sicurezza del codice (es.  Sonar Qube ).
Esperienza con architetture a  Microfrontend  e uso di strumenti di build moderni come  Vite , Web Assembly o Turborepo.
Conoscenze base di backend ( Node.js ) e confidenza con l'ambiente a riga di comando Linux ( Bash ).

Cosa offriamo:
Modalità  ibrida  (lavoro da remoto con presenza flessibile presso la nostra sede di  Torino ).
Inquadramento contrattuale a tempo indeterminato, con Retribuzione Annua Lorda (RAL) competitiva e commisurata all'effettiva anzianità/esperienza del candidato.
Opportunità di lavorare su prodotti ad alto contenuto tecnologico legati alla sicurezza, con stack aggiornati e focus sulla qualità del codice.
Contesto stimolante, dinamico e fortemente collaborativo.

Ral: 38-42k
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ary